> Move warmboot_save_sdram_params() to later in the boot sequence. This > code relies on devicetree to get the address of the memory controller > and with upcoming changes for SPL boot it gets called early in the > boot process when devicetree is not initialized yet. > In fact I suppose you could move it much later to board_init() or even into the warmboot setup code there.
